How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 02150?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| 02150 Studio Apartments | $2,381 | $1,550 | $3,578 |
| 02150 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,756 | $1,205 | $7,105 |
| 02150 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,366 | $1,900 | $7,556 |
| 02150 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,868 | $2,600 | $6,076 |
| 02150 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,661 | $3,050 | $4,695 |
